Sloping, tiered roofs define the iconic design of temples in Kerala, perfectly suited for heavy monsoons and blending with natural aesthetics.
Kerala temple design uses natural materials like wood and granite, emphasizing eco-friendly practices in temple architecture.
Elaborate wooden carvings in Kerala Temple Architecture depict mythological stories, enhancing the artistry of the temple interiors.
Kerala temples emphasize proportional, compact architecture, focusing on simplicity and harmony in their overall design.
The Nalambalam layout forms the core structure, surrounding the sanctum and offering a balanced, functional design in temple architecture.
The Chuttambalam courtyard in Kerala temples blends open spaces with functionality, a key element of traditional temple design.
Koothambalam is an enclosed theatre in Kerala temples where art meets devotion, enriching the cultural depth of temple architecture.
Kerala temple murals vividly depict Hindu epics, enhancing the artistic appeal and storytelling aspect of traditional temple design.
Kerala Temple Architecture strictly adheres to Vastu Shastra principles, ensuring spiritual and cosmic harmony in every structure.
This Temple Architecture harmoniously integrates with nature, surrounded by lush greenery, sacred ponds, and serene landscapes.
Lamp towers in Kerala temples enhance architecture, adding charm and splendor to the traditional temple design.
During festivals, Kerala temples transform with lights and decorations, highlighting their architectural beauty and cultural significance.
Kerala Temple Architecture balances spiritual purpose with artistic excellence, creating timeless spaces for worship and heritage.
Metal-clad doors in Kerala temples reflect intricate craftsmanship, a hallmark of Temple Architecture's unique detailing.
Sacred temple tanks and wells in Kerala temples symbolize purity, enhancing the spiritual and functional aspects of temple design.
